Sandra Müeller is a scholar working on Pharmacology,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and Developmental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Sandra Müeller has authored 4 papers receiving a total of 4 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 1 paper in Pharmacology, 1 paper in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and 1 paper in Developmental Biology. Recurrent topics in Sandra Müeller's work include Animal Behavior and Reproduction (1 paper), Mineral Processing and Grinding (1 paper) and Fluid Dynamics and Mixing (1 paper). Sandra Müeller is often cited by papers focused on Animal Behavior and Reproduction (1 paper), Mineral Processing and Grinding (1 paper) and Fluid Dynamics and Mixing (1 paper). Sandra Müeller coll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Czechia. Sandra Müeller's co-authors include Michael Kopf, Gaëtane Le Provost, Margot Neyret, Nico Blüthgen, Andrew M. Liebhold, Torben Hilmers, Michael Scherer‐Lorenzen, Soyeon Bae, Barbara Bobrowska‐Korczak and Kris Verheyen and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Conservation Biology and Chemical Engineering Science.

1.
Tylianakis, Jason M., Dean P. Anderson, Andrea Larissa Boesing, et al.. (2025). Mobile species’ responses to surrounding land use generate trade-offs and synergies among nature’s contributions to people.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ences. 122(45). e2505401122–e2505401122.
2.
Mitesser, Oliver, Zuzana Buřivalová, Sandra Müeller, et al.. (2024). Unexpected soundscape response to insecticide application in oak forests. Conservation Biology. 39(3). e14422–e14422. 1 indexed citations
3.
Bobrowska‐Korczak, Barbara, Sandra Müeller, Quentin Ponette, et al.. (2024). Factors affecting composition of fatty acids in wild-growing forest mushrooms. Mycologia. 116(3). 381–391.
4.
Müeller, Sandra, et al.. (2019). Combining small-scale screening methods to predict microorganism floatability. Chemical Engineering Science. 207. 1353–1363. 3 indexed citations
